Verify Implementation

Run verification commands after implementing changes to ensure correctness.

Verification Sources

Check thoughts/notes/commands.md (created by discover-project-commands skill) for:

  • Available test commands
  • Linting commands
  • Build commands
  • Other project-specific verification

IMPORTANT: Always Use Verification Agent

DO NOT run verification commands directly in main context.

Spawn a verification agent to run checks and return summary:

Task(subagent_type="Bash",
     prompt="Run verification commands from plan success criteria:
     - make test
     - make lint
     - make build
     [list all automated checks from plan]

     Return concise summary:
     - If all pass: ✅ All verification passed
     - If any fail: ❌ Verification failed
       - List ONLY the failing checks
       - Include first few lines of error
       - Omit stack traces and verbose output

     Maximum output: 2k tokens")

Why use an agent:

  • Raw output can be 10k+ tokens (floods main agent context)
  • Agent filters to only essential info (1-2k tokens)
  • Keeps main agent focused on implementation
  • Part of token management strategy (see spawn-implementation-agents)

Agent returns:

  • ✅ Pass status or ❌ Fail status
  • Only failed checks (not successful ones)
  • First few lines of errors (not full output)
  • Actionable information only

Common Verification Steps

1. Run Tests

Check commands.md, then run appropriate command:

  • make test - If Make target exists
  • npm test - If npm script exists
  • go test ./... - Direct Go command
  • pytest - Direct Python command

2. Run Linting

Check commands.md, then run:

  • make lint - If Make target exists
  • npm run lint - If npm script exists
  • golangci-lint run - Direct Go command
  • eslint . - Direct JavaScript command

3. Build Check

Check commands.md, then run:

  • make build - If Make target exists
  • npm run build - If npm script exists
  • go build ./... - Direct Go command

4. Type Checking (if applicable)

  • npm run typecheck - TypeScript
  • mypy . - Python
  • Go builds include type checking

Verification Workflow

  1. Check for commands.md: Read thoughts/notes/commands.md
  2. Run automated checks: Use commands from reference doc
  3. Report results: Show pass/fail for each check
  4. Manual verification: Prompt for manual testing if needed

Handling Failures

If verification fails:

  1. Show the error output
  2. Analyze the error
  3. Fix the issue
  4. Re-run verification
  5. Don't mark task complete until all checks pass

Example

# Read the commands reference
cat thoughts/notes/commands.md

# Run appropriate commands
make test
make lint
make build

# All pass? Mark phase complete in plan
# Any fail? Debug and fix before proceeding
